ItineraryThis is a typical itinerary for this productStop At: Estatua do Marques de Pombal, Estacao de Metro do Marques de Pombal Praca Marques de Pombal, Lisbon 1250-161 PortugalYou start by being picked-up for your tour at the designated meeting point in Lisbon.This tour begins as you head south from Lisbon to Setúbal, a region best known for its fish culture and the natural reserve. Duration: 45 minutesStop At: Setubal, Setubal, Setubal District, AlentejoIn Setúbal you will board a modern catamaran, for a relaxing and enjoyable cruise on the Sado Estuary, where you’ll learn about the resident bottlenose dolphins and hopefully be able to observe some wild dolphins in their natural environment. Duration: 15 minutesStop At: Reserva Natural do Estuario do Sado, Rua Claudio Lagrange 8, Setubal 2900-324 PortugalHere you will board a modern catamaran, for a relaxing and enjoyable cruise on the Sado Estuary, where you’ll learn about the resident bottlenose dolphins and hopefully be able to observe some wild dolphins in their natural environment. The cruise takes between 2 1/2 to 3 hours, but may take longer. The duration may change due to weather conditions or the dolphins being more "shy"...Note: for wildlife preservation and respecting the dolphins habitat, we will be a maximum of 30 minutes near the dolphins with the ship. See the natural reserve of Arrábida, take in the stunning views, and learn about the area’s history. Duration: 3 hoursStop At: Estrada do Castelo de Sao Filipe, Setubal 2900-300 PortugalFrom the ocean, and before returning to the old city centre of Setúbal you’ll see a few of the region’s historic monuments and sites like the Arrábida Convent and the Saint Filipe Fort.Before returning to Lisbon, you’ll stop at a few sights in the Arrabida Mountain range, from where you can marvel at the natural reserve and get a “land view” of this region.Duration: 30 minutesStop At: Praca Marques do Pombal, Avenida da Liberdade Rotunda, Lisbon PortugalLastly we will head back to Lisbon for you to be dropped -off at the same location as your pick-up.Duration: 45 minutes
